The history of the crotto

The historic Crotto dei Platani restaurant, founded in 1855, owes its name to the traditional cellar dug into the rock, called “crotto“, characterized by the Sorèl, a stream of cold air that mysteriously comes from the bowels of the mountains and maintains a constant temperature of about 8° C in both winter and summer, making it an ideal environment for maturing wine and curing meats and cheeses.

The thirties

In the Thirties this place, halfway between Brienno and Argegno, at the foot of Monte Gringo, was the small headquarters of the most elusive smugglers in the area, who mingled with lumberjacks and local people to escape the controls.

The cavadini family

In 1977 Fernando and Renata Cavadini took over the property and began a process of transformation and growth of the restaurant business, making it a point of reference for lovers of good food.
